A data profile of the people who buy, follow and care about Die Rosenheim-Cops in Germany — modelled from more than twelve digital signal sources. Die Rosenheim-Cops has an estimated audience of 2,262,219 people in Germany.
The average Die Rosenheim-Cops fan in Germany is 49.9 years old, more female, and lives primarily in Bayern.
The audience is concentrated in Bayern, Nordrhein-Westfalen, Baden-Württemberg.
Top brand affinities include Andy Borg, Roland Kaiser, Red Bull Records, with strongest over-indexing on Andy Borg (17.05× the country average).
Demographically, the Die Rosenheim-Cops audience skews more female with an average age of 49.9, and over-indexes on personality traits such as Tradition, Community Orientation.
Compared to the country baseline, this audience shows distinctive patterns across 20 brand affinities and 16 regions tracked by Rascasse.
The typical Die Rosenheim-Cops fan in Germany is more female, around 49.9 years old, with strong Tradition tendencies and a notable affinity for Andy Borg.

Audience size is the estimated number of people in Germany who actively search for Die Rosenheim-Cops. Affinity is an over-index ratio: 2.0× means the audience is twice as likely to engage with that brand or trait as the country average. Reach is the estimated number of audience members in a region. Regional and brand-affinity tables are sorted from strongest signal to weakest.
This audience profile is generated by Rascasse from anonymized search-behavior signals across Germany. For methodology see methodology. Affinity values are over-index ratios vs. the country average (1.0 = baseline). Audience sizes are estimated, not measured.
